Nairobi (NBO) to Saint-Georges-de-l'Oyapock Airport (OXP) Flight Distance

The flight distance from Jomo Kenyatta International Airport (NBO) in Nairobi, Kenya to Saint-Georges-de-l'Oyapock Airport (OXP) in Saint-Georges-de-l'Oyapock Airport, GF is 9,877 kilometers (6,137 miles / 5,333 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 13h, flying west at a heading of 274°.

This is an ultra-long-haul route, one of the longest in aviation. It requires wide-body aircraft with extended range capability such as the Airbus A350-900ULR or Boeing 777-200LR. Passengers should prepare for an extended flight with multiple meal services.

This is an international route connecting Kenya with GF. It is an intercontinental flight between Africa and South America. Travelers should check visa requirements, customs regulations, and any travel advisories before booking.

Time zone information: When it's 12:10 in Nairobi, it's 06:10 in Saint-Georges-de-l'Oyapock Airport. With a 6-hour time difference, travelers should plan for significant jet lag. It typically takes one day per hour of time difference to fully adjust.

There is a significant elevation difference of 5,284 feet between the two airports. Saint-Georges-de-l'Oyapock Airport sits lower than Jomo Kenyatta International Airport. Travelers arriving at the higher-elevation airport should be aware of potential altitude effects.

The return flight from Saint-Georges-de-l'Oyapock Airport (OXP) to Nairobi (NBO) follows a heading of 91° (east). Actual flight times may vary depending on wind conditions, air traffic, and the specific aircraft used.
